SOURCE: Scales show weight in kg. How to get them to show lbs.
Body Fat Monitor/Scales: TBF-611, TBF-612, TBF-621, TBF-622, BF-541, TBF-560, TBF-572. UltimateScales: 2000, 2001, 2001T. BF-662, BF-555, BF-556, BF-558, BF-559, BF-625, BF-626.
Press the Set and Up Arrow buttons at the same time. Release the buttons, the display will flash. Press the Arrow button to cycle through each weight mode until just the mode that you require is displayed. Then press Set. The display screen will flash to confirm your selection and store in memory.
Note: If weight mode is set to pounds or stone-pounds, the height programming mode will be automatically set to feet and inches. Similarly, if kilograms is selected, height will be automatically set to centimeters.
SOURCE: resetting the scale
You do not reset the scale. It only saves the last recorded weight of the user. So, if you weighed yesterday, it will put your recorded weight in memory. The next time you select your user number and step on the scale, it will compute the difference from your previous record and save your current weight.
SOURCE: Err 1 message on Taylor Lithium Elec Scale model 7346
This is a reply I received from Taylor customer support. I have followed this procedure enough times to wear out the original battery and still get the Err 1 message. You may have better luck.
Thank you for your e-mail. The reboot below may clear the error from
your scale. You may need to do this several times to completely reboot
the system. Please let us know if you have any questions or continue to
display the Error.
1. Remove the battery from the scale
2. Set the scale on the floor without the battery in place.
3. Stand on the scale for 10 seconds (still without the battery)
4. Carefully replace the battery without turning the scale on.
5. Using only one foot, tap the scale or apply just enough pressure to
turn on the display. (It should show dashes or zero's) IMMEDIATELY
REMOVE YOUR FOOT.
6. Let the scale turn off
7. Step on the scale for a weight reading
